Ingredients

  • 2 cups (12 ounces) semisweet chocolate chips
  • 1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
  • 1 jar (7 ounces) marshmallow creme
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• Pineapple or banana chunks, apple slices, marshmallows, cubed angel food or pound cake

Instructions

  1. In a microwave, microwave the first five ingredients just until melted; whisk until smooth. Transfer to a fondue pot and keep warm. Serve with fruit and/or cake.
